The BPSC Judicial Services includes 3 stages of selection - Prelims, Mains, and Interview. Each of these stages carries a different weightage. We have compiled all details of the BPSC Judicial Services selection process in this article.
- The BPSC Judicial Services prelims carries a weightage of 250 marks.
- The Mains exam comprises 5 compulsory papers and 3 optional papers.
- The Interview carries 100 marks.
- The Prelims is merely qualifying in nature. The merit list will be prepared based on the scores of the Maisn exam and Interview.

BPSC Judicial Services Selection Process 2023
BPSC Judicial Services selection process comprises 3 stages in the selection procedure. Candidates who will be attending the recruitment will have to clear all the stages in order to be considered for the post. The selection process will be as given below.
BPSC Judicial Services Selection Process | |
Stage | Marks |
Prelims | 250 |
Mains | 1050 |
Interview | 100 |

BPSC Judicial Services Selection Process - Prelims Examination

The BPSC Judicial Service prelims examination will be an objective written examination. The exam pattern is given below.
Subject | Marks |
General Studies | 100 |
Law | 150 |
Total | 250 |
- The prelims examination will consist of two different papers namely Paper I and Paper II.
- Paper I will be of General Studies and Paper II will consist of Law.
- The exam will be of 250 marks in total. Paper I will carry 100 marks and paper II will be off 150 marks.
- Only candidates who score the required cut off marks will be selected for the mains exam of the BPSC Judicial Service Selection Process.
- The Prelims is only qualifying in nature,

BPSC Judicial Services Selection Process - Mains Examination
The written exam will consist of 5 compulsory papers and 3 optional papers. Some important details about the BPSC Judicial Services Mains exam include the following:
- The mains examination will be 1050 marks in total.
- Each paper will carry different marks.
- Candidates who score the cut off marks as required will be selected for the interview which will be the last stage in the selection process.
Paper Type | Subjects | Marks |
Compulsory Paper | General Knowledge including Current Affairs | 150 |
Elementary General Science | 100 | |
General Hindi | 100 | |
General English | 100 | |
Law of Evidence and Procedure | 150 | |
Optional Paper (Any 3) | Constitutional Law of India and England | 150 |
Hindu Law and Mohammedan Law | 150 | |
Transfer of Property Act, Principles of Equity, Law of Trusts, and Specific Relief Act. | 150 | |
Law of Contract and Torts | 150 | |
Commercial Law | 150 | |
Total | 1050 |

BPSC Judicial Services Selection Process Interview Process
Candidates who qualify the mains examination will be considered eligible for the interview process. Key highlights of this stage of selection are:
- The personal interview will be conducted for a total of 100 marks.
- Candidates need to score a minimum of 35% marks to qualify this stage of the BPSC Judicial Services selection process
